Software Engineer IV

Overview

Remote
$100,000 - $120,000
Full Time
Accepts corp to corp applications

Skills

Ruby on Rails
PostgreSQL
Agile
AWS

Job Details

Hi

Job Title: Software Engineer IV
Location: Remote New Jersey

Role Summary

We re looking for a Software Engineer IV with strong PostgreSQL and Ruby on Rails expertise to design and build high-performing data applications and APIs for Clients Commercial Payments team. You ll collaborate with product managers, architects, and developers to deliver scalable, reliable backend systems.

Key Responsibilities

  • Design, develop, and deploy back-end applications using Ruby on Rails and PostgreSQL
  • Build and optimize APIs for scalability and performance
  • Collaborate with cross-functional teams to deliver new features
  • Maintain clean, well-documented, and testable code
  • Troubleshoot bottlenecks, ensure performance, and support production releases
  • Participate in architecture discussions and code reviews

Required Skills

  • 8+ years in software development and database engineering
  • Strong hands-on experience with Ruby on Rails and PostgreSQL
  • Deep understanding of API design, database optimization, and performance tuning
  • Experience with RESTful APIs, WebSockets, and Git
  • Solid understanding of software development principles and Agile practices

Nice to Have

  • Experience with AWS, Azure, or Google Cloud Platform
  • Familiarity with GraphQL and modern API design
  • Exposure to CI/CD pipelines and DevOps tools
  • Experience with testing frameworks and security best practices
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.